Transaction 63df1fe663c9c880ccb1758aea7e8a15971748c1aeb36ba01f5941331e494a2d

1 Input
2 Outputs
  • 63df1fe663c9c880ccb1758aea7e8a15971748c1aeb36ba01f5941331e494a2d:0
  • value  1130464
    address  3HfreXXRxvPvj3gW1wrpDEQEvthitp1aSh
  • 63df1fe663c9c880ccb1758aea7e8a15971748c1aeb36ba01f5941331e494a2d:1
  • value  6338217
    address  16zKf5pTUBLXqTeFKHiqhkGefWg8vS3rKK